Understanding Japan Import Tax
When you buy from US ship to Japan, you should be aware of the import tax regulations. For personal imports, orders with a total value (including shipping) under 16,666 JPY are generally exempt from duty and consumption tax. However, skincare products are sometimes subject to specific pharmaceutical limits (typically 24 pieces per item). Since you are likely only buying one or two tubes of Theratone, you should be well within the limits for personal use.
